2. Securing High-Impact Internships and Placement Years

Practical experience remains the undisputed gold standard on any modern CV. Participating in structured internships or a sandwich placement year transforms theoretical knowledge into tangible industry competence. The University of Huddersfield has forged powerful alliances with industry giants, NHS trusts, engineering powerhouses, and creative agencies, making it easier for students to secure meaningful placements.

When searching for internships, it is vital to balance structured formal schemes with proactive speculative applications. Employers value candidates who take the initiative. Furthermore, completing a placement year often leads directly to a graduate job offer before you even enter your final year of studies.

5. Comparing Career Pathways: Traditional Roles vs. Modern AI-Integrated Roles

To understand where the modern job market is heading, it is helpful to look at how roles have evolved. The following breakdown illustrates the shifting paradigm of graduate expectations in 2026:

Industry SectorTraditional Graduate Focus (Past)Modern 2026 Graduate Focus
Marketing & MediaCopywriting, traditional ad campaignsAI-driven content strategy, data analytics, multi-channel digital execution
Finance & AccountingManual auditing, basic bookkeepingFinancial modeling, predictive data forecasting, automated compliance
Engineering & TechCAD design, isolated coding tasksSystems integration, sustainable green tech engineering, collaborative AI coding
Business & ManagementGeneral administration, internal reportingAgile project management, cross-functional leadership, digital transformation

Q1: How early should I start looking for graduate internships at The University of Huddersfield?
You should begin exploring internship options during your first year by registering with the university's career portal and attending introductory employability workshops. Major structured placement schemes for penultimate-year students often open their application windows early in the autumn term.
